How to Use the S&P 500 Price API
Using the S&P 500 Price API is straightforward. First, you need to sign up for an account with a provider that offers this API, like Indices API. Once registered, you’ll receive an API key that grants you access to real-time data. The API can be integrated into your trading platform or app, allowing you to fetch the latest S&P 500 prices and indices with ease. With simple HTTP requests, you can pull data on current prices, historical trends, and other essential metrics that inform your trading strategies.
To use the API, you simply construct a request URL that includes your API key and the desired parameters. This URL will return data in a structured format, making it easy to parse and use within your application. The Importance of Real-Time Market Data for Traders
Real-time market data is the backbone of effective trading strategies. Traders need accurate, up-to-the-minute information to make decisions in a volatile market. The S&P 500 Price API provides this crucial data, ensuring that you are always in the loop. Delays in information can lead to missed opportunities or losses, so having a reliable source like the S&P 500 Price API can make all the difference.
For example, consider a trader who relies on outdated data. They might decide to buy or sell based on trends that have shifted significantly, leading to poor outcomes. In contrast, by utilizing the S&P 500 Price API, traders can analyze live data, allowing for quick adjustments to their strategies as market conditions change.
